A 37-year-old man has died after reportedly falling into a septic tank while conducting drainage work in Matungulu, Machakos County.
Police said the incident occurred on Wednesday, May 13, at Afya Phase One Estate in the Malaa area after the case was reported to authorities.
Officers who visited the scene established that the man, identified as James Kariuki Maina, had been hired earlier in the day to pump out water from a newly constructed septic tank.

Preliminary findings indicate that while operating a generator pump to drain water from the 18-foot-deep concrete tank, he allegedly slipped and fell inside, where he drowned.
Police, together with members of the public, later retrieved the body. No visible physical injuries were observed.
The body was taken to Kangundo Level 4 Hospital Mortuary awaiting postmortem examination after the scene was documented.
In a separate incident in Mbooni East Sub-county, Makueni County, police are investigating a suspected murder after a man’s body was discovered in a dam.
According to police, residents alerted authorities on Wednesday after noticing a decomposing body believed to have been dumped at Kyangamati Dam within a farm in Waia Location.
Officers recovered the body of an unidentified adult male, estimated to be about 45 years old, wrapped in a gunny bag and weighed down with stones in the water.

The body showed signs of decomposition, indicating it had been in the dam for some time.
The scene was processed before the remains were taken to Makueni County Referral Hospital Mortuary for identification and preservation as investigations continue.
